They stop being effective. At 50% if there is another supplier they will be cheaper and get picked. If you set it to 100% or 200% it doesn’t make much of a difference. Trade just stops between the countries unless there is only a single supplier for what you need.
The idea is that China can’t live without selling stuff to the US… But it’s easier for them than it would be for the US.
